How to take screenshots? (F12 not working)
I'm relatively new to Steam, and one of the things I'm wanting to use it for is screenshots. Every search result I've seen says to use F12 to take screenshots, but when I press F12 on my laptop, literally nothing happens. (Also, where are the screenshots stored? I look in my regular Screenshots folder on my laptop, and there's nothing there.)

Oh, and yes, Steam Overlay is enabled. Still nothing.

The only thing that works is the Prt Sc button, but that's extremely imprecise (there's a second-long lag between pressing the button and when the screenshot comes up), and it includes other stuff in the background of Steam.

All I want is in an internal Steam-only screenshot feature that works instantaneously when I press the button. (Some of the shots I want to take have to be timed almost to the exact frame.) Is there a way to do this? How do I get F12 working for this?

Screenshots are store in your steam folder

The path is:
C:\ Program files (x86) \ Steam \ userdata \ SteamID \ 760 \ remote\ App ID \ screenshots

Where it says “Steam ID” replace it with the numbers that make up your Steam ID number, and for “App–ID replace it with the game’s ID number

Otherwise you can access this file path directly by right clicking on any screen shot you have already taken and select "show on disk"

Most games take screenshots with the F12 button. If your playing a possibly indie game that uses rpg maker, then no, the f12 button will not take screenshots, but will shut down the game your playing. In that case, you can make the screenshot by putting it in the artwork section of the game.

Althlough the default key is F12 you can change it to a key you prefer.

Steam > Settings > In game > Take a screenshot
